Are bifacial solar panels better than single-sided solar panels?

While modern solar panel performance has improved dramatically across the board, bifacial panels can generate up to 30% more electricity than traditional single-sided panels in optimal conditions. This increased production comes from their ability to capture light on both sides of the panel.

Do bifacial solar panels produce more energy?

Bifacial solar modules use both sides of the panel to produce energy. Manufacturers say that bifacial solar panels can generate up to 30% more energy than monofacial panels. What is a dual-sided solar system?

The dual-sided design typically incorporates high-quality solar cells sandwiched between two layers of highly transparent glass, ensuring optimal light transmission and durability. Each side is protected by anti-reflective coatings and specialised encapsulation materials that enhance light absorption while providing robust weather protection.
